Broken Keys
In the event of accidental falls or general wear and tear, it is very common for keys to break into locks. This can be quite frustrating as it can make it difficult to open the doors, and could cause further damage.
There are fortunately various methods that you can use to retrieve keys that are damaged from a lock. The best method depends on how deep within the lock the damaged key is located and the tools you have.
First, lubricate your lock using WD-40 (or another lubricant for locks). This will allow the damaged piece to slide out with less resistance. If the broken piece is protruding from the lock then you can make use of a screwdriver to grab it and remove it.
If the damaged part is located a bit from the lock's edge You could also try using a hook extractor tool. This is a thin barbed piece made of metal typically found in a locksmith's kit. The hook is put into the lock beside the broken piece and rotated so that the barb gets into the soft brass of the key, causing enough friction to draw it out.
If the broken key section is in line with the lock's edge then you can fix it using a small screw. The screw's tip is placed in an open space in the cylinder walls where the keyway is the lock, and then it is slowly rotated. The spiral threads of the screw will penetrate the soft brass of the broken key and grip it until it is able to take it out.
Depending on how far the broken key sticks out of the lock, you may be able to grab it using pliers and pull it out. If the broken part is too deep inside the lock, you will require locksmith.
Ignition Repair
The ignition system is complicated and designed to follow a series of steps in order for your vehicle to start. If anything goes against that sequence, your vehicle's engine will not start. There are a few things you can do if your key is stuck. The first thing to do is to ensure that the vehicle isn't in gear or neutral. If it is in neutral or gear, turn the steering to put it into park.
Then try wiggling the key a bit but be careful not to use too much force. This could damage the ignition cylinder and break or bend the keys. If that doesn't work you may have to remove the battery and remove the ignition switch. This is a difficult job and requires specialized tools. It is recommended to leave it to a professional it if you don't have the proper tools.
A malfunctioning ignition cylinder is another common reason for a jammed automobile key. This can be caused by wear and tear or a worn-out or damaged key. The teeth on the key can wear down and not line up with the ignition wafers and cause it to become stuck.
A malfunctioning anti-theft device can sometimes interfere with the insertion or removal of keys. Typically the systems can be reset or bypassed by an expert.

Transponder Keys
Cars with transponder keys require a particular key with an embedded chip in it to be able to start the vehicle. Locksmiths in auto shops can duplicate these keys, but the cost is usually higher than a basic non-transponder key. Shop around to find the best price. Many local locksmiths offer a cheaper alternative to dealerships and offer all the benefits of a new key.
Although it is possible to copy a transponder's key without the original, doing this can be quite risky and requires advanced programming skills. Many people choose to hire a professional to handle the task because it guarantees that the chip will be properly programmed and your vehicle's security is protected.
Transponder keys come with a number of advantages However, the most obvious benefit is that they make hot wiring your car key repair shop near me more difficult. Transponder keys send signals to the ignition which can be read by the car. If they don't match the car won't start. This is an excellent way to protect your vehicle from burglars and lock picks.
